Transaction cae36891a0094332e28892097303a98f2f05ce9773c4f206c62c144595afcbc6
1 Input
-
a1523d356e34e1725d0a3c9213c0d165c2712f91dd60db0c7d2e0021c7a68109:0
OP_DATA_48(48) 4402206c5cfdc377cbfe4016d038705368abea2be8b42e6517352cf1837a79bb30233a022002d7a8517a2247f2b42589
1 Outputs
- cae36891a0094332e28892097303a98f2f05ce9773c4f206c62c144595afcbc6:0
value 2345589
address 3QuxHQk8BehKbeE6VuPVuD7EZPYXicBT8F